feat: offline SMS fallback for important notifications

断网时把验证码、来电用短信发到 iPhone:
- ConnectivityMonitor: NetworkCallback 监听在线状态
- CarrierDetector: SIM MCC+MNC 映射移动/联通/电信/广电
- CarrierBalanceQuery: 发免费查询短信拿套餐短信余量,解析回执
- SmsFallbackForwarder: 限频(5min)/余额(≤5挂起)/紧要性检查
- NotificationProcessor 拦截运营商回执(10086/10010/10001/10099)
- 设置页新增短信兜底卡片,首页余额耗尽警告

版本 1.3.0 → 1.4.0

@@ -0,0 +1,54 @@
package com.a2i.forwarder.core
import android.content.Context
import android.os.Build
import android.telephony.TelephonyManager
/**
* 运营商检测:根据 SIM 的 MCC+MNC 映射到国内运营商。
* 提供余额查询用的服务号 + 查询指令。
*/
object CarrierDetector {
enum class Carrier(
val displayName: String,
val serviceNumber: String?, // 余额查询服务号(免费)
val queryCmd: String?, // 查询指令(发送到此服务号)
) {
CHINA_MOBILE("中国移动", "10086", "CXDX"),
CHINA_UNICOM("中国联通", "10010", "CXTC"),
CHINA_TELECOM("中国电信", "10001", "108"),
CHINA_BROADCASTING("中国广电", "10099", null), // 无统一查询指令
UNKNOWN("未知运营商", null, null);
companion object {
fun fromName(name: String?): Carrier =
entries.firstOrNull { it.name == name } ?: UNKNOWN
}
}
// MCC+MNC → 运营商(中国大陆 460)
private val mncMap = mapOf(
// 中国移动
"46000" to Carrier.CHINA_MOBILE, "46002" to Carrier.CHINA_MOBILE,
"46004" to Carrier.CHINA_MOBILE, "46007" to Carrier.CHINA_MOBILE,
// 中国联通
"46001" to Carrier.CHINA_UNICOM, "46006" to Carrier.CHINA_UNICOM,
"46009" to Carrier.CHINA_UNICOM,
// 中国电信
"46003" to Carrier.CHINA_TELECOM, "46005" to Carrier.CHINA_TELECOM,
"46011" to Carrier.CHINA_TELECOM, "46012" to Carrier.CHINA_TELECOM,
// 中国广电
"46015" to Carrier.CHINA_BROADCASTING, "46018" to Carrier.CHINA_BROADCASTING,
)
fun detect(context: Context): Carrier {
return runCatching {
val tm = context.getSystemService(Context.TELEPHONY_SERVICE) as? TelephonyManager
?: return Carrier.UNKNOWN
val simOperator = tm.simOperator // 形如 "46000"
if (simOperator.isNullOrBlank() || simOperator.length < 5) return Carrier.UNKNOWN
mncMap[simOperator] ?: Carrier.UNKNOWN
}.getOrDefault(Carrier.UNKNOWN)
}
}
@@ -0,0 +1,54 @@
package com.a2i.forwarder.core
import android.content.Context
import android.net.ConnectivityManager
import android.net.Network
import android.net.NetworkCapabilities
import android.net.NetworkRequest
import kotlinx.coroutines.flow.MutableStateFlow
import kotlinx.coroutines.flow.asStateFlow
/**
* 监听网络连通性(是否能访问互联网)。
* 暴露 isOnline: StateFlow<Boolean>,断网时短信兜底转发器据此降级。
*/
class ConnectivityMonitor(private val context: Context) {
private val _isOnline = MutableStateFlow(false)
val isOnline = _isOnline.asStateFlow()
private var registered = false
private val callback = object : ConnectivityManager.NetworkCallback() {
override fun onAvailable(network: Network) { refresh() }
override fun onLost(network: Network) { refresh() }
override fun onCapabilitiesChanged(network: Network, caps: NetworkCapabilities) { refresh() }
}
fun start() {
if (registered) return
val cm = context.getSystemService(Context.CONNECTIVITY_SERVICE) as? ConnectivityManager
?: return
val request = NetworkRequest.Builder()
.addCapability(NetworkCapabilities.NET_CAPABILITY_INTERNET)
.build()
runCatching { cm.registerNetworkCallback(request, callback) }
registered = true
refresh()
}
fun stop() {
if (!registered) return
val cm = context.getSystemService(Context.CONNECTIVITY_SERVICE) as? ConnectivityManager
runCatching { cm?.unregisterNetworkCallback(callback) }
registered = false
}
private fun refresh() {
val cm = context.getSystemService(Context.CONNECTIVITY_SERVICE) as? ConnectivityManager ?: return
val active = cm.activeNetwork
val caps = active?.let { cm.getNetworkCapabilities(it) }
_isOnline.value = caps != null &&
caps.hasCapability(NetworkCapabilities.NET_CAPABILITY_INTERNET) &&
caps.hasCapability(NetworkCapabilities.NET_CAPABILITY_VALIDATED)
}
}
